2025年哪些做图软件能将创意高效转化为视觉成果结合2025年技术发展趋势,优秀的做图软件需具备智能协作、跨平台无缝衔接及实时渲染三大核心能力。经过多维测评,Adobe Firefly AI、Canva Pro+及Figma X成为当前最...
如何在2025年用Java打造高性能网页开发环境
如何在2025年用Java打造高性能网页开发环境随着量子计算云平台逐渐普及,Java网页开发正经历着从传统Spring框架向云原生异构计算的转型。我们这篇文章将解析三种主流技术栈配置方案,并重点介绍GraalVM与量子算法加速器的整合方法

如何在2025年用Java打造高性能网页开发环境
随着量子计算云平台逐渐普及,Java网页开发正经历着从传统Spring框架向云原生异构计算的转型。我们这篇文章将解析三种主流技术栈配置方案,并重点介绍GraalVM与量子算法加速器的整合方法。
2025年Java网页开发生态现状
不同于2020年代初期,当前Java生态呈现出明显的"三足鼎立"态势:传统的Spring Boot 6.x仍占据企业级市场40%份额;轻量级Micronaut凭借其原生镜像特性在边缘计算领域快速发展;而新兴的Quarkus 4.0则通过与Kubernetes深度集成,成为混合云部署的首选方案。
值得注意的是,Oracle最新发布的Java 23 LTS版本正式内置了WebAssembly编译器,这使得Java代码可以直接在前端运行,模糊了前后端的技术边界。
硬件加速方案对比
在神经网络处理器(NPU)已成为服务器标配的当下,开发者在选择技术栈时需特别注意框架对硬件加速的支持程度。经基准测试,使用GraalVM+TensorRT的组合可使图像处理API的吞吐量提升17倍,但会牺牲约30%的启动时间。
实战开发环境配置
推荐采用模块化开发方案:基础层使用JDK 23的jlink工具创建最小运行时;业务层按功能划分为独立模块;AI加速层则通过JEP 457定义的开放计算接口调用专用硬件。
对于IDE选择,IntelliJ IDEA 2025新增的量子代码分析插件能自动检测潜在的性能瓶颈,其基于大语言模型的代码补全准确率已达到82%。
性能优化关键策略
内存管理方面,新一代ZGC收集器将停顿时间控制在1ms以内,但需要特别注意其与新版HTTP/3协议的兼容性问题。数据库连接推荐采用支持自动弹性伸缩的R2DBC 3.0,相比传统JDBC在云环境下可降低40%的资源消耗。
Q&A常见问题
量子计算对Java开发有何具体影响
目前主要影响集中在加解密和优化算法领域,Oracle已提供量子安全算法库作为标准扩展,但常规业务系统尚无需改造。
如何平衡传统架构与云原生需求
建议采用渐进式改造策略,优先将无状态服务容器化,利用Service Mesh实现新旧系统互通。
前端技术选型建议
虽然Java 23支持WebAssembly,但复杂交互界面仍推荐配合TypeScript框架,注意选择支持Java类型定义生成的解决方案。
标签: Java网页开发云原生架构量子计算编程性能优化策略2025技术趋势
相关文章
- 详细阅读
- 如何在Windows系统上安全便捷地启用远程桌面连接详细阅读

如何在Windows系统上安全便捷地启用远程桌面连接截至2025年,通过RDP协议建立本地远程桌面连接仍是跨设备办公的主流方案。我们这篇文章将系统讲解Win10Win11启用远程桌面的全流程,重点解析防火墙配置、用户权限设置和安全性优化三...
- 详细阅读
- 企业如何选择最适合自身需求的客户管理软件详细阅读

企业如何选择最适合自身需求的客户管理软件综合评估2025年主流CRM系统发现,Salesforce仍保持全功能领先地位,但Zoho在性价比和本土化服务方面展现出明显优势,而HubSpot则在中小企业营销自动化领域保持独特竞争力。选择时需重...
- 详细阅读
- 详细阅读
- 详细阅读
- 详细阅读
- 如何在2025年安全高效地建立Docker远程连接详细阅读

如何在2025年安全高效地建立Docker远程连接随着云原生技术的普及,Docker远程连接已成为跨环境部署的关键能力。我们这篇文章从实战角度解析三种主流方案(SSH隧道、TLS加密端口直接暴露、JumpServer代理),并针对2025...
07-04959容器安全实践云原生架构Docker高级配置零信任网络跨平台部署
- 详细阅读
- 详细阅读
- 详细阅读
- 详细阅读
- 详细阅读
- 详细阅读
- 详细阅读
- 详细阅读
- 详细阅读
- 详细阅读
